G80 Steering Wheel Noise

Hi,

Wondering if anyone has same problem as me. I have been trying to figure out this rattle coming from the steering wheel.

Car is 2022 m3c. At slow speed going over uneven pavement or turning into a driveway, I would hear this rattle coming from the steering wheel. Very faint rattle like some plastic pieces are loose. It sounded like it could be behind the airbags or from the steering rack itself. No suspension mod 100% stock. If yall experienced this please share the fix. Thanks.

not sure if it is same issue here, i hear rubber scrached each other from steel wheel. brought it back to dealer ship, told me that need to consult with BMW as they have not seen it before. Now it got replacement of the steering column. as per staff in dealership, they found internal fault within column.

however when i take the car back, the bloody noise is still there but just not as loud as before......
